Pros

My experience with Trip has been positive overall. Management is open-minded when it comes to exploring new markets and business opportunities. Local team is fantastic. Most managers care about their people and prioritise balancing business goals with personal well-being, helping prevent burnout from the sometimes ambitious expectations set by offshore managers. Management seeks out feedback through open forums held every two months, fostering two-way communication. Three days in the office and two working from home. Melbourne is in a shared office, but Sydney office provides snacks regularly. Team lunches and happy hour events help foster a positive and social environment.

Cons

Some internal processes feel outdated and overly bureaucratic designed by Shanghai, which frustrates a lot!
